Transaction 7181250e27ba903585f22d02b52547d2c892ab411981c97e00f2e4d4c6de71ca
1 Input
1 Output
-
7181250e27ba903585f22d02b52547d2c892ab411981c97e00f2e4d4c6de71ca:0
- value
- 84889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ecab0c2534be559e9ab6b627ef1c140d15d4d3bc OP_EQUAL
- address
- 3PGQJQBDECmcvUtXoxdg9k5hAHWEEk1wLr